Continuous learning in a growing company Junior Recruiter **Location:** Jardines del Pedregal, Álvaro Obregón, CDMX **Work Mode:** 100% on-site **Position Type:** Full-time **Department:** People / Talent Acquisition **Salary:** $15,000–$16,000 gross monthly, commensurate with experience About Grupo Balle At **Grupo Balle**, we are a Mexican company with over 18 years of experience delivering comprehensive solutions in maintenance, infrastructure, and project operations nationwide. We are currently looking to integrate a **Junior Recruiter** into our **People** team, with proven experience in filling operational, technical, and administrative vacancies. We are not simply seeking someone who posts job openings; rather, we seek a professional capable of attracting, screening, following up on, and closing candidates in high-volume hiring processes. **Job Objective** Execute end-to-end talent acquisition, screening, interviewing, and candidate follow-up processes to fill operational, technical, and administrative vacancies efficiently, accurately, and on time—supporting project continuity and talent growth at Grupo Balle. **Main Responsibilities** * Post job openings on job boards, social media, specialized groups, and other recruitment channels. * Conduct proactive candidate sourcing for operational, technical, and administrative profiles. * Conduct telephone screenings and initial interviews focused on experience, availability, location, employment stability, and salary expectations. * Perform daily follow-ups on contacted, scheduled, confirmed, interviewed, and viable candidates for the next stage. * Maintain updated tracking of open positions, progress, candidate status, and recruitment metrics. * Coordinate interviews with department leaders and ensure timely communication with candidates. * Support mass recruitment events, field recruitment, and urgent vacancy coverage. * Ensure an excellent candidate experience from first contact through to process closure. **Essential Requirements** * **Minimum Education:** Completed or near-completion undergraduate degree in Psychology, Business Administration, Human Resources, Communications, Pedagogy, Industrial Relations, or related field. * Minimum **1–2 years of experience in mass recruitment**. * Demonstrable experience recruiting operational, technical, administrative, or field personnel. * Proficiency with job boards such as Indeed, Computrabajo, OCC, Facebook, WhatsApp, employment groups, and candidate databases. * Ability to conduct fast and effective telephone screenings. * Capacity to manage high-volume candidate follow-ups. * Basic/intermediate proficiency in Excel or Google Sheets for candidate tracking and reporting. * Availability to work **100% on-site** at Jardines del Pedregal, Álvaro Obregón, CDMX. * Easy access to the work location. **Important Note** Candidates without prior mass recruitment experience will not be considered—even if they hold relevant academic qualifications. This role requires constant follow-up, clear communication, and the ability to meet vacancy coverage targets. If your background is exclusively in administrative roles, customer service, or general HR without mass recruitment experience, this position may not be suitable for you. **Desirable Qualifications** * Experience recruiting technicians, general assistants, supervisors, operational staff, maintenance personnel, construction workers, logistics staff, or service personnel. * Field recruitment experience. * Basic knowledge of recruitment metrics: vacancy coverage rate, interview attendance rate, conversion rate, time-to-fill, and early turnover. * Experience working with weekly or monthly coverage targets. **Performance Indicators** Performance in this role will be primarily measured by: * Number of positions filled within target timelines. * Number of candidates contacted per day. * Conversion rate of contacted candidates to completed interviews. * Attendance rate of scheduled candidates. * Quality of candidates referred for second interviews. * Daily updating of recruitment tracking records. * Reduction in number of critical open vacancies. **We Offer** * Monthly **gross salary** of **$15,000–$16,000**, based on experience. * Statutory benefits. * Direct employment with the company. * Growth opportunity within the People area. * Participation in recruitment processes for nationwide projects. * Continuous learning within a growing company. **Work Location** Jardines del Pedregal, Álvaro Obregón, CDMX. **Working Hours** Monday to Friday, full-time on-site.
